Output 7d7bbae053ce85ee78d17adef57bc3af40fa95b0d8cf3c5e3e98cba92bbfd182:1

value
350849304
script pubkey
OP_HASH160 OP_PUSHBYTES_20 faf42a71a66a52c10f2ff3134e89c14689ac7284 OP_EQUAL
address
3QZwMSNnM5Z3D2WG7fyBycNuU87U2VTx9R
transaction
7d7bbae053ce85ee78d17adef57bc3af40fa95b0d8cf3c5e3e98cba92bbfd182
spent
true